Course structure

• Introduction to Child Social Emotional Learning • Developmental Psychology in Children • Social Emotional Competencies in Childhood • Trauma-Informed Practices for Children • Building Resilience in Children • Mental Health Awareness in Child Development • Family and Community Partnerships in Child SEL • Integrating SEL into Educational Curriculum • Assessing and Monitoring Child Social Emotional Learning Progress • Ethical and Cultural Considerations in Child SEL
